Linux下Nginx負載搭建

2021-08-25 07:33:10 字數 4159 閱讀 1792

shell>> cd /tmp

shell>> wget

shell>> tar xzvf nginx-0.7.64.tar.gz

shell>> cd nginx-0.7.64

然後開始編譯安裝,先配置編譯變數:

--with-http_stub_status_module解釋一下:

# --user            是指啟用程式所屬使用者

# --group           是指啟動程式所屬組

# --prefix          是指nginx安裝目錄(不是源**目錄)

# --sbin-path       是指nginx命令位置

# --conf-path       是指配置檔案路徑

# --error-log-path  是錯誤日誌路徑

# --http-log-path   是訪問日誌

其他是一些臨時檔案的路徑和做linux service需要用到的檔案

如果需要監控服務需安裝此監控狀態模組:

然後make:

shell>> cd /tmp/nginx

shell>> make

shell>> make install

現在已經可以通過nginx命令來啟動了。

2、配置服務

但是我們如果想要把nginx做成乙個服務,必須要寫乙個shell.

簡單說一下,

# chkconfig:   - 85 15 所有執行級別,啟動優先順序85, 關閉優先順序15

# processname: 程序名稱

# config:      nginx配置檔案位置

# config:      系統會優先找第乙個,如果找不到再去找第二個

# pidfile:     程序id存放檔案,用來存放程式啟動後的程序id

# source function library.  linux常用的方法庫,有興趣可以去看看service *** status 就使用了裡邊的乙個方法

# source networking configuration.  網路配置

esac已經做成chkconfig了。

3、配置反向**

配置一下nginx反向**需要修改/etc/nginx/nginx.conf配置檔案

nginx 負載均衡搭建

負載均衡是我們大流量 要做的乙個東西,下面我來給大家介紹在nginx伺服器上進行負載均衡配置方法。參考 測試環境 測試網域名稱 www.threegroup.space a伺服器ip 123.56.255.173 主 b伺服器ip 101.200.159.138 c伺服器ip 123.56.255....

Nginx搭建負載環境

nginx的負載均衡支援4種演算法,round robin least connected ip hash 和weightd。round robin的意思是迴圈輪詢。nginx最簡單的負載均衡配置如下 預設的負載均衡演算法就是迴圈輪詢 如上配置我們採用的就是迴圈輪詢,其會把接收到的請求迴圈的分發給其...

nginx搭建負載均衡

負載均衡 針對web負載均衡簡單的說就是將請求通過負債均衡軟體或者負載均衡器將流量分攤到其它伺服器。負載均衡的分類如下圖 今天分享一下nginx實現負載均衡的實現,操作很簡單就是利用了nginx的反向 和upstream實現 伺服器名稱 位址作用 a伺服器 192.168.0.212 負載均衡伺服器...